Chelsea sold Salah in 2016, not me, says Mourinho


Soccer Football - Champions League - Liverpool Training - Melwood, Liverpool, Britain - April 23, 2018 Liverpool's Mohamed Salah during training Action Images via Reuters/Carl Recine

(Reuters) - Former Chelsea manager Jose Mourinho is not surprised by Liverpool forward Mohamed Salah's exploits in the current campaign and said the decision to sell the Egyptian to Roma in 2016 was made by the London club.

Salah joined Chelsea under Mourinho in 2014 but failed to establish himself at Stamford Bridge and was loaned out to Fiorentina and Roma before a permanent move to the Stadio Olimpico outfit in 2016.
